Alabama is one of the most storm-prone areas in the world, making it especially important to protect your home with good insurance. While many state-sponsored grants can help, such as the Strengthen Alabama Homes program, finding affordable coverage can be a challenge.
Homeowners in Alabama pay an average of $2,988 per year for a $300,000 dwelling coverage policy, according to Insurify data — higher than the national average of $2,532 per year.
Here’s what you should know about finding homeowners insurance in Alabama for the right price.
Alabama homeowners pay a yearly average of $3,210 for a $300,000 dwelling coverage policy with a $500 deductible.
Allstate is the cheapest home insurance company in Alabama, with average monthly premiums of $142 for $300,000 in dwelling coverage.
Many Alabama insurers require a separate windstorm or hurricane deductible for claims stemming from each specific storm.
Best home insurance companies in Alabama
No single insurer will be the best home insurance company for everyone. But a few companies in Alabama stand out for providing better coverage in different situations.
Farmers: Best for property damage coverage
USAA: Best for military members and veterans
State Farm: Best for financial stability
Allstate: Best for affordable coverage
Foremost: Best for mobile home owners
Our editorial team analyzed dozens of regional and national home insurance companies that sell policies in Alabama to assess which offer the best rates, coverage options, customer service, and savings to homeowners. We prioritized competitive rates, 24/7 customer service, homeownership discounts or bundling options, and specialty or supplemental coverages.
Cheapest home insurance in Alabama
Allstate is the cheapest home insurance company in Alabama. It charges $142 per month, on average, according to Insurify data.
Check out some other cheap Alabama insurers in the table below.
Insurance Company | Average Annual Premium: With $300,000 in Dwelling Coverage |
|---|---|
| Allstate | $1,704 |
| Farmers | $1,992 |
| Foremost | $2,832 |
| Travelers | $2,856 |
| USAA | $3,048 |
| Nationwide | $3,060 |
| Auto-Owners | $3,120 |
| State Farm | $3,204 |
| Encompass | $3,312 |
| COUNTRY Financial | $3,744 |
How much does homeowners insurance cost in Alabama?
On average, policyholders pay $249 per month for a $300,000 dwelling coverage policy, according to Insurify data. That’s higher than the national average of $211 per month for a comparable policy.
Home insurance rates tend to be higher in Alabama because of its severe weather risks — storms often pummel homes in the state, especially near the coast. All those storms mean filing more home insurance claims, and that can also affect your rates.
Cheapest home insurance companies in Alabama by dwelling coverage
Dwelling coverage protects your home and any attached structures if a covered peril damages or destroys them. The higher your home’s replacement cost, the more you’ll pay to insure it. The table below shows average annual home insurance costs in Alabama for different dwelling coverage amounts.
Insurance Company | Average Annual Premium |
|---|---|
| Allstate | $1,404 |
| Farmers | $1,464 |
| Foremost | $1,824 |
| Travelers | $2,076 |
| USAA | $2,244 |
| Nationwide | $2,328 |
| Auto-Owners | $2,388 |
| State Farm | $2,484 |
| Encompass | $2,616 |
| COUNTRY Financial | $2,868 |
Insurance Company | Average Annual Premium |
|---|---|
| Allstate | $1,704 |
| Farmers | $1,992 |
| Foremost | $2,832 |
| Travelers | $2,856 |
| USAA | $3,048 |
| Nationwide | $3,060 |
| Auto-Owners | $3,120 |
| State Farm | $3,204 |
| Encompass | $3,312 |
| COUNTRY Financial | $3,744 |
Insurance Company | Average Annual Premium |
|---|---|
| Allstate | $2,604 |
| Farmers | $3,348 |
| State Farm | $4,464 |
| USAA | $4,476 |
| Nationwide | $4,536 |
| Travelers | $4,572 |
| Auto-Owners | $4,704 |
| Foremost | $4,860 |
| Encompass | $4,908 |
| COUNTRY Financial | $5,580 |
Insurance Company | Average Annual Premium |
|---|---|
| Allstate | $3,780 |
| Farmers | $5,004 |
| State Farm | $5,856 |
| USAA | $6,120 |
| Nationwide | $6,492 |
| Auto-Owners | $6,504 |
| Encompass | $6,624 |
| Travelers | $6,804 |
| Foremost | $7,092 |
| COUNTRY Financial | $7,920 |
Alabama homeowners insurance cost by city
The average cost of home insurance is fairly consistent across the major cities in Alabama, with one exception: Mobile. Surrounded by wetland swamps and highly exposed to the coast, Mobile ranks among the most storm-prone areas in the country.
The table below shows the average cost of home insurance in several cities in Alabama.
City | Average Annual Premium: With $300,000 in Dwelling Coverage |
|---|---|
| Montgomery | $2,496 |
| Huntsville | $2,520 |
| Birmingham | $2,628 |
| Mobile | $4,620 |
What homeowners should know about insurance in Alabama
Homes in coastal states, like Alabama, are especially vulnerable to windstorm damage.[?] To help homeowners, the state offers a tax deduction for residents who set up a “catastrophe savings account” to help rebuild their home and personal property after natural disasters.[?] The following examples are some of the most common risks Alabama homeowners face.
Hurricanes
Alabama doesn’t get quite as many hurricanes as neighboring states.[?] But hurricane losses in the state may increase by as much as 132% over the next 10 years, one recent study predicts.
Home insurance companies often set separate deductibles and coverage rules for named storms like hurricanes. You can lower these costs by getting a FORTIFIED home certification, which can unlock home insurance discounts under Alabama state law. Homeowners in certain counties are even eligible for grants to help cover the cost of these home upgrades.[?]
Tornado damage
Being in the heart of Tornado Alley, where the most dangerous tornadoes in the world regularly roll through, Alabama residents are well aware of what these storms can do to homes.
As with hurricanes, your home insurance policy will cover damage from tornadoes, although some companies charge a separate wind deductible for each storm. Check your policy exclusions for more details.
Flood damage
While storms can affect Alabama residents anywhere in the state, widespread flooding danger is a bit more limited to the coastal counties. Keep in mind, though, that one-third of flood damage claims come from outside of high-risk areas.[?]
Standard home insurance policies don’t cover flood damage. You can check your home’s flood risk on FEMA’s flood map. If you live in a high-risk flood zone, your lender may require you to buy separate flood coverage through the National Flood Insurance Program (NFIP). Even if your lender doesn’t require flood insurance, it’s a good idea to buy it separately to better protect your home.
How much homeowners insurance do you need in Alabama?
No state laws require homeowners to carry insurance. But your mortgage lender will probably require you to have a policy as a way to protect its investment in your home.[?]
If you have a mortgage you’ll generally need to buy enough home insurance coverage for at least the value of your mortgage. You may also need to buy a flood insurance policy if your home is in a flood plain.
Financial experts recommend insuring your home for the full cost of rebuilding it. Consider opting for replacement cost coverage if you can, since that’ll cover the full cost of replacing or repairing your home. Actual cash value coverage is cheaper, but it doesn’t cover the full cost to rebuild your home after you file a claim.[?]
It’s important to understand exactly what your home insurance policy covers before purchasing, so you know you have all the coverages you need.
How to contact the Alabama Department of Insurance
The Alabama Department of Insurance regulates the insurance industry in the state. It also helps support homeowners through programs like Strengthen Alabama Homes and resolves disputes with insurers.
Here’s how to get in touch with the organization:
Email address: [email protected]
Phone number: 1 (334) 241-4141 or 1 (800) 433-3966
Mailing address: P.O. Box 303351, Montgomery, AL 36130-3351
Alabama homeowners insurance FAQs
If you’re shopping for home insurance in Alabama, the additional information below can help as you research your coverage options.
The average cost of Alabama home insurance is $2,988 per year for a policy with $300,000 in dwelling coverage, according to Insurify data. If you purchase add-on coverage, such as flood insurance, your costs will increase.
Allstate offers the most affordable homeowners insurance rates in Alabama, Insurify data shows. It charges an average of $142 per month.
No. Alabama doesn’t require homeowners to carry insurance. But most mortgage lenders require borrowers to have homeowners insurance policies. If you own your home outright, you aren’t required to insure your home. But keeping an active insurance policy is still important to make sure your finances are protected.
The best way to lower the cost of homeowners insurance is to shop around for coverage. Bundling multiple policies with the same insurance company, like life insurance and car insurance, can also help you lower your home insurance rates.
The average premium for a policy with $200,000 in dwelling coverage in Alabama is $186 per month, according to Insurify data. Your cost might vary based on other factors, like your claims history, deductible amount, home’s age, and personal property coverage.
Yes. Your home’s age can affect how much you pay for coverage. The older your home, the higher the cost of your homeowners insurance.
)
)
)
)
)
)
)